Memorial Park was originally established in 1924 as a tribute to fallen soldiers from World War I, and today, it serves as both a historic landmark and a vital part of the city’s recreational landscape. Hermann Park is a 445-acre urban park in Houston, Texas, situated at the southern end of the Museum District.
Miller Outdoor Theatre is a unique, open-air performing arts venue in Houston's Hermann Park that has provided free, high-quality performances to the public since 1923.
